【oracle】查看数据库最近执行了哪些sql语句
前言
- oracle 12.1.0.2.0
- 为了确定功能是否生效,需要查看数据库最近执行的sql语句,在里面找到想要的SQL语句
查看数据库最近执行了哪些sql语句
# 查看1小时内执行的sql语句,并按照执行时间倒序排序
select s.LAST_ACTIVE_TIME,s.SQL_TEXT,s.SQL_FULLTEXT,s.FIRST_LOAD_TIME,s.LAST_LOAD_TIME,s.EXECUTIONS from v$sql s
where s.SQL_TEXT like '%DUAL%' and s.LAST_ACTIVE_TIME>sysdate-1/24
order by s.LAST_ACTIVE_TIME desc
- LAST_ACTIVE_TIME : TIme at which the query plan was last active。sql语句最后一次的执行时间。
- FIRST_LOAD_TIME : Timestamp of the parent creation time.
- LAST_LOAD_TIME : Time at which the query plan (heap 6) was loaded into the library cache.
- EXECUTIONS : Number of executions that took place on this object since it was brought into the library cache。执行次数。
【oracle】查看数据库最近执行了哪些sql语句相关推荐
- linux查看mysql表空间使用率_Oracle查看数据库表空间使用情况sql语句
Oracle查看数据库表空间使用情况sql语句 SELECT UPPER(F.TABLESPACE_NAME) "表空间名", D.TOT_GROOTTE_MB ...
- c#执行多句oracle,C#一次执行多条SQL语句,Oracle11g数据库
由于经常执行SQL语句,如果一条一条执行效率低下. oarclecmd.CommandText = sqlstr; oraclecmd.ExecuteNonQuery(); sqlstr 可以写成如下 ...
- oracle多条sql语句常量,如何在Oracle中一次执行多条sql语句
有时我们需要一次性执行多条sql语句,而用来更新的sql是根据实际情况用代码拼出来的 解决方案是把sql拼成下面这种形式: begin update TB_VG set seq = 1, vessel ...
- mysql 查询执行过的sql_查看mysql已经执行过的sql语句
概述 很多时候,我们需要知道 MySQL 执行过哪些 SQL 语句,比如 MySQL 被注入后,需要知道造成什么伤害等等.只要有 SQL 语句的记录,就能知道情况并作出对策.服务器是可以开启 MySQ ...
- ado.net Oracle中一次执行多条sql语句
begin update TB_VG set seq = 1, vessel_id = 'Jin14', vessel_type = 'TRACK' where batch_number = '20 ...
- oracle查看执行过的语句,oracle 查询执行过的SQL语句
MySQL开启日志记录查询/执行过的SQL语句 作为后端开发者,遇到数据库问题的时候应该通过分析SQL语句来跟进问题所在,该方法可以记录所有的查询/执行的SQL语句到日志文件. 方法有几种,但是个人觉 ...
- 查看mysql某人执行了什么语句_详解MySQL如何监控系统全部执行过的sql语句
概述 考虑这么一个场景,开发系统时有个模块执行很慢,但是又不知道这中间涉及到什么sql,就可以设想在没什么业务量的时候来监控数据库全部执行过的sql语句,方便排查问题. 涉及命令 1.开启genera ...
- ORACLE 查看有多个执行计划的SQL语句
在SQL优化过程,有时候需要查看哪些SQL具有多个执行计划(Multiple Executions Plans for the same SQL statement),因为同一个SQL有多个执行计划一 ...
- oracle数据库中最常用的sql语句
对SQL语句进行调整,往往有一项前期工作,就是定位最常用的SQL 语句.Oracle数据库可以从多个方面取得SQL语句.如从数据库自身的存储过程或者函数中取得,也可以从前台的应用程序中取得.所以,数据 ...
最新文章
- Django Response对象3.4
- Spring Cloud【Finchley】-08使用Hystrix实现容错
- 华为8x计算机横屏怎么设置,荣耀8x怎么设置横屏显示 两种操作方法详细介绍
- boost::units模块实现用常量测试所有运算符的组合的测试程序
- 2017年秋招美团Java程序员开发,看我如何拿到offer
- Ajax请求利用jsonp实现跨域
- 重装系统解决:CUPS服务未启动,不能管理打印机
- pe中怎么卸载服务器系统更新,方法四: 使用专用工具卸载系统更新补丁(和方法三类同...
- java isbn_ISBN书号查询示例代码
- 大学英语六级翻译分类高频词汇
- 数据库与开源编译器框架LLVM
- 计算机协会游戏方案,计算机协会社团各月工作总结及工作计划
- Guided Anchor论文笔记
- 谁说码农不懂浪漫?(js写的'老婆生日快乐'特效)
- norflash/nandflash 启动分析 转
- CATIA CAA二次开发专题(三)---------创建自己的Workbench
- python 各种开源库
- “路漫漫其修远兮,吾将上下而求索”——读“做中学”有感 20155328
- 【LINUX】r,w,a,r+,w+,a+概念和区别
- C语言-两个单链表的合并
热门文章
- Balluff推出刀具识别系统
- JS原型、原型链深入理解
- 【iHMI43 应用演示】之 modbus 协议(从机)通信演示
- 自己写的DBUtil数据库连接工具类
- IT自动化:自动化的网络管理变得很重要
- C# webrequest 抓取数据时,多个域Cookie的问题
- php中的var_dump()方法的详细说明
- sql server try...catch使用
- android alertdialog 背景透明,Android Alertdialog弹出框设置半透明背景
- 解决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)